Transaction 562bf9e402895d35df749b227fa08716a944270b641e41a145b1c8236988748a
1 Input
2 Outputs
- 562bf9e402895d35df749b227fa08716a944270b641e41a145b1c8236988748a:0
- 562bf9e402895d35df749b227fa08716a944270b641e41a145b1c8236988748a:1
value 752309
address 1KtxXzaaCoX88u3Wr1usyfjgM5nsDiGYW9
value 17590968
address 1HcjGfQdRoHqXX1oJGgzMwW5TGsVmDFmsJ